The Indian Fighter is a 1955 Western film starring Kirk Douglas as Johnny Hawks, a man who fought Indians in the Civil War and tries to prevent a war between Sioux and settlers. The film is based on a story by Robert L. Richards and was shot in Bend, Oregon.
Fighter is a 2024 Indian Hindi-language action film directed by Siddharth Anand, based on a story he wrote with Ramon Chibb. Produced by Viacom18 Studios and Marflix Pictures, it stars Hrithik Roshan , Deepika Padukone and Anil Kapoor while Karan Singh Grover , Akshay Oberoi and Rishabh Chawhney play supporting roles. Hank Worden was an American actor who appeared in many Westerns, especially John Ford films and John Wayne movies. He was born in 1901, became a rodeo rider and a wrangler, and died in 1992.

Indian 2 is a sequel to Indian (1996) and stars Kamal Haasan as Senapathy, an ageing freedom fighter who fights corruption. The film was released on 12 July 2024 and was a box-office bomb, receiving negative reviews for its length, plot and direction.
Fighter is the soundtrack album of a 2024 Hindi film starring Hrithik Roshan, Deepika Padukone and Anil Kapoor. It features six original songs composed by Vishal-Shekhar, with lyrics by Kumaar, and two theme songs by Sanchit-Ankit Balhara.
